On Friday, the External Affairs Minister of India told the Lok Sabha that the United States sanctions on Iran have nowhere affected India's Chabahar...
Construction has been completed in Alaska, and testing of a new long-range radar is beginning, which can track both intercontinental ballistic missiles and hypersonic...
According to the National Energy Administration's announcement on November 29, the installed capacity of wind power generation in China reached 30150,000 kW, doubling from...